DuPont’s agriculture business took a hit in the second quarter by lower corn seed sales, North American herbicide volumes and higher seed inventory write-downs.

杜邦表示,这一结果部分被更高的种子价格、更高的杀虫剂产量、更高的大豆产量和更低的种子投入成本所抵消。

Sales for the agriculture segment, which is DuPont’s largest business by sales, totaled $3.62 billion, unchanged from the year-ago period. The segment’s operating earnings were $836 million, down 11% from $941 million a year earlier.

“While lower Agriculture earnings impacted our results this quarter, we continue to see strong science-driven growth in this segment over the long term,” said CEO Ellen Kullman.
